do you get the resort benefits such as pool, housekeeping, room service etc..
You get access to the same resort amenities, but not the member perks. Some resorts have room service, some don't. I think you have to be attached to a hotel to get that (like VWL, BWV, and BCV). AKV should be in that list, too.
Housekeeping is different if staying on points than staying on cash. You get limited service (Trash and Towel on day 4, full on day 8) with points. If you pay cash to WDW for the room, you get full housekeeping. You can order housekeeping for individual days for a per-day charge, if you like.
You won't get perks like pool hopping, free dvd rentals, and free valet, though renters have reported getting them in the past. I believe they are now asking for the blue DVC member card instead of letting the room key indicate your status.
